Ottawa drivers heading toward a G2 or G road test have no shortage of options, from long-running family operations to newer schools built around online Beginner Driver Education (BDE). This list was put together by reading each school's own website, its Google review counts and ratings where posted, and third-party award listings like the Consumer Choice Award. It leans toward schools with MTO-approved BDE programs, coverage across Ottawa's suburbs, and a track record that shows up in more than one place online.

3. Safe Drive Ontario
Area: Downtown Ottawa, Nepean, Kanata, Orleans, Gloucester, Barrhaven, Stittsville, Centretown, Westboro and Vanier · Specialty: BDE plus targeted G2 city-manoeuvre and G highway training · Rating: 5.0 on Google (120+ Ottawa reviews)
Safe Drive Ontario builds part of its program around the specific DriveTest centres students will face, with practice runs geared to Walkley and Canotek for G2 and highway sessions on the 417 and Autoroute 50 for G. Instructors are described as bilingual in English and French, and the school also serves Peterborough outside the Ottawa market.

9. Premier Roads
Area: Downtown Ottawa, Kanata, Nepean, Barrhaven and Orleans, with a location on Bryarton Street · Specialty: Route-specific training on Ottawa's own DriveTest centre conditions
Premier Roads markets itself around "real-world skills, not just passing the test," with instruction built around Ottawa-specific routes. It's MTO-approved, which the school notes can shorten the G1 waiting period from 12 months to 8, and serves a mix of teens, newcomers, seniors and nervous first-time drivers.

How We Built This List
This list was compiled from public sources: each school's own website, Google review counts and ratings where they were publicly posted, and third-party recognition such as the Consumer Choice Award. Nobody at ottown tested, rode along with, or personally verified any of these schools' instruction. This is not a paid placement, and no business on this list has any affiliation with ottown or its operator. Last reviewed August 2026.
